Understanding Oocyte Donation: The Science and Ethics

Oocyte donation presents a complex interplay of scientific advancements and ethical considerations. Reproductive professionals carefully screen potential donors to ensure the well-being of both the donor and the recipient. The procedure involves retrieving mature oocytes from the donor, which are then combined with sperm in a laboratory setting. Thereafter this, the resulting embryos are implanted into the recipient's uterus, offering the potential for pregnancy and parenthood.

However, oocyte donation raises several ethical issues. The anonymity of donors must be protected, while also ensuring the welfare of any children born through this process. Furthermore , the economic implications for donors and recipients must be carefully considered. Open and transparent communication between all parties involved is crucial to navigating these complex ethical dilemmas.
